Transaction 70597c8183e1c615df8b21f6ecdf738a9a3f3e987788f1c65de7ffe171e5b508

1 Input
2 Outputs
  • 70597c8183e1c615df8b21f6ecdf738a9a3f3e987788f1c65de7ffe171e5b508:0
  • value  2776542
    address  1Ecbx6V1ucDb4rvAjuLkwzj6bpcCz7c4qJ
  • 70597c8183e1c615df8b21f6ecdf738a9a3f3e987788f1c65de7ffe171e5b508:1
  • value  15713872
    address  1MUwC6cY9vCvN5U2VASps21afEe8LqisnB